I'm buying -- sure not shorting. Steve Harmon says:

FATB pre-announced Q3:00 revenues of $10M and earnings between ($0.80)-($0.82) comparing favorably to our estimates of $9.0M and ($0.83). When earnings are officially released on November 23rd, we expect to learn more on eMatter, a new model for digital publishing that was launched in the quarter. Although its still early since the launch, we are hoping to gather data-points related to the level of traffic and the level of content that is being attracted. We believe eMatter potentially meets the needs of a huge untapped market, connecting publishers and authors with customers and believe that it could grow virtually similar to eBay's model.

Equal market caps gives FATB a price of about $1600 when compared to EBAY. I'll take it.

Also look at IDC -- would be nice to peg an early big mover with technology and patents to back it up. No splits, 400M market cap, tiny PE.
